What Are Magnetic Door Locks?
Magnetic door locks consist of two main elements: an electro-magnetic lock (frequently described as a mag-lock) and a matching armature plate. The electromagnetic lock is set up on the door frame, while the armature plate is mounted on the door itself. When the lock is stimulated, an electro-magnetic field is produced, causing the armature plate to be drawn in to the lock. This leads to a secure bond that avoids the door from being opened.
Components of a Magnetic Door Lock SystemPartDescriptionElectro-magnetic LockThe main locking mechanism that generates a magnetic fieldArmature PlateA piece of ferromagnetic material that reacts to the magnetic fieldPower SupplyProvides electricity to the electromagnetic lockControl SystemCan consist of gain access to control devices (keypads, card readers)How Do Magnetic Door Locks Work?
The operation of a magnetic door lock depends upon two crucial concepts: electrical energy and magnetism. When the electrical current circulations through the electromagnetic coil within the lock, it produces a magnetic field. This field attracts the armature plate, resulting in a tight hold. On the other hand, when the power supply is interrupted, the magnetic force vanishes, permitting the door to open.

While magnetic door locks have lots of benefits, they likewise feature certain challenges that must be dealt with:
Power Dependency: Magnetic locks are completely reliant on electrical energy. In case of a power blackout, the locks might not operate unless they are battery-backed.Possible False Alarms: If not properly installed or calibrated, magnetic doors can be vulnerable to false alarms.Minimal Resilience Against Physical Force: While they offer a strong holding force, they can be vulnerable to physical attacks if applied with the right tools.FAQs About Magnetic Door Locks1. 3. How much power do magnetic door locks consume?
The power intake can differ based upon the specific model, but most magnetic locks just draw power when engaged, generally consuming around 500 to 600 milliamps.

5. What happens if the power heads out?
If the magnetic lock is not equipped with a battery backup, the door will unlock when power is lost, providing a prospective security danger.
